About Zehra Fadoo

Zehra Fadoo is a scholar working on Hematology, Genetics and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, having authored 50 papers that have together received 391 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ia research (12 papers), Childhood Cancer Survivors' Quality of Life (9 papers), Neutropenia and Cancer Infections (6 papers),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research (5 papers), Blood properties and coagulation (4 papers), Platelet Disorders and Treatments (4 papers), Iron Metabolism and Disorders (4 papers) and Renal cell carcinoma treatment (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Hematology (152 citations), Genetics (76 citations) and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(82 citations). Zehra Fadoo has collaborated with scholars based in Pakistan, Kenya and Tanzania. Frequent co-authors include Naureen Mushtaq, Ahmed Naqvi, Asim Belgaumi, Mohammad Khurshid, Muhammad Imran Nisar, Ali Faisal Saleem, Iqbal Azam, Naila Nadeem, Salman Naseem Adil and Raza Sayani.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Pediatric Hematology/Oncology, Child s Nervous System, Pediatric Blood & Cancer, BMJ Open and JCO Global Oncology.
